But I know that not everyone enjoys the taste of plain, nonfat yogurt. So what to do if you don’t want the sugar-laden stuff from the store, you know that nonfat plain is the healthiest, but you still find that it’s too bland and not flavorful enough to eat as is?
Flavor it naturally! The advantage of doing that is that you start off with the cleanest of foods, then add just the amount you need to make it more flavorful. So you know exactly what gets into your body, and you are in control of how sweet the end result is.
Some of these I tried and loved. Others are suggestions from fans that were posted on our Facebook page:
1. Honey. This one is a classic. Pour a tablespoon of honey over 8oz plain nonfat VOSKOS® and mix well.
2. Jam. As simple as honey, simply add a tablespoon of jam to 8oz plain nonfat VOSKOS® and mix well.
3. Mashed fruit. I love mashing a ripe banana and adding it to my VOSKOS® plain nonfat.
4. Raisins. Raisins are fun because they add chewiness in addition to flavor.
5. Dark chocolate. Melted and swirled into the yogurt, or use a tablespoon of chocolate syrup.
6. Peanut butter. Use a hand-held whisk or a fork to whip 8oz VOSKOS® Plain Nonfat with 1 tablespoon peanut butter. Add a teaspoon of chocolate syrup for some extra indulgence!
7. Chocolate chips. Use dark chocolate chips – dark chocolate is actually good for you, in moderation.
8. Granola. A quarter cup of granola adds just the right amount of sweetness and crunch. Of course, you can always opt for YoGreek, dual-cup Greek yogurt that comes with pre-measured crunchy granola!
9. Stevia and Vanilla. To create your own vanilla yogurt and keep it low in calories, add stevia to taste and a drop of vanilla extract to your VOSKOS® Plain Nonfat.
10. Apple butter. Mix one tablespoon apple butter into your VOSKOS® Greek Yogurt for a fruity, creamy, wonderful treat.

How do you sweeten plain nonfat Greek yogurt? ›
A little drizzle of honey or maple syrup, about a teaspoon, may be all that you need to enjoy your plain Greek yogurt. Consider that a teaspoon of honey and maple syrup provides about 6 and 4 grams of sugar, respectively. That's less than some of the flavored yogurt options.
What is a healthy way to sweeten yogurt? ›
Applesauce. Whether homemade or from a jar, no-sugar-added applesauce is a perfect sweetener for yogurt. It stirs in easily and is already is most people's pantry or fridge. Applesauce contains 2 grams fiber per ½ cup serving for only 50 calories.

How to sweeten Greek yogurt for diabetics? ›
Pairing yogurt with blueberries, strawberries, or raspberries can add natural sweetness to your yogurt. Plus, berries are naturally low in sugar and a good source of fiber. One-half cup of raw raspberries provides 4 grams of fiber, 7.3 grams of carbohydrates, and just 2.7 grams of sugar.

Which yogurt has the most probiotics? ›
Kefir contains more probiotics than any yogurt. With up to 61 different strains of microbes, it can be an excellent source of probiotics. People use specific clusters of microbes called kefir grains to ferment the milk. Interestingly, these microbes can exist together without any other food source.

What is the difference between yogurt and Greek yogurt? ›
Yogurt is milk that goes through a culturing process with a starter culture to convert its lactose to lactic acid. Greek yogurt is regular yogurt that has a thicker, more dense consistency due to a filtering process that removes whey and liquids or through the addition of whey protein and milk protein concentrates.
Is plain nonfat Greek yogurt supposed to taste sour? ›
More sour taste: Plain Greek yogurt has a more sour taste than regular yogurt as a result of its more rigorous fermentation and straining process.
